So the accident damage that you many have seen on the Youtube video, was done apparently by sliding off the road into what I can only describe a curb maybe. I don't think any moose's where harmed. This appears to have bent the lower control arm but everything else seems to measure up ok.
This will be my first job, aside from cleaning so I can actually move the car.

The wishbone is designed to collapse and that is what looks to have happened
